I first saw this when I was a kid but now as a lawyer, it’s freaking hilarious because of how incredibly unethical this is.

Edit - for those who don’t know, misrepresentations in advertisements are unethical for lawyers. It doesn’t have to be fraudulent. Even misleading or unnecessarily unclear advertisements can be problematic. For example, I can’t legally use the word “specialize” to describe my practice even though I’m an expert in the state. That term is reserved exclusively for types of law that require you to take a special test like Admiralty or patent law.

Here, he is changing the fee structure. It is unquestionably a material issue (something extremely important to the representation). In a contingency fee arrangement, you would not pay the lawyer directly, and they would instead take a portion of your compensation received if they were successful, typically 1/3. As such, there is no money down. He is changing it to a flat fee arrangement or a retainer arrangement where money is required upfront.

Nothing is unethical about this change, but the way in which he did it was definitely unethical. He didn’t even remove the original text. In fact, it’s still reads exactly the same way. The only difference is he added punctuation to provide a meaning the entirely different from the written text. This is already pretty bad but now imagine that someone who is not a native English speaker had to parse this out.

Unjerking for a minute here...

This is undoubtedly multifactorial, but there are at least 5 major contributing factors at work here.

First, the decline in traditional religious values and related marriage practices.  I am not religious at all and I don't recommend it.  But traditional religions did push marriage and childbearing early on as a social and spiritual duty, which if nothing else kept sex on the plate.  Only a couple generations ago the average age of marriage was around 20.  Now being single well into one's 30s is considered normal.

This promotes serial dating, which nowadays is often arranged via online services.  Some people do get a lot of sex off these but I don't think it's a normal distribution.  Most dudes are not competitive enough to do well.  Back in the day a subpar unattractive dude could just trad marriage, or go to the local roller disco and find their rough female equivalent for a hookup, but that's less feasible now, at least on a population level. 

This is similar to the winner take all nature of our current late stage capitalist economy, where the economic middle class has been increasingly squeezed and strained.  Yes some people do very well, but a lot of us are living paycheck to paycheck and working multiple jobs.  Being exhausted and stressed makes it tougher to keep up the front of success and confidence to do well on social media and tinder. 

Also, compared to previous eras, Americans are fat and anxious and overworked and unattractive.  

So what do our tired single lonely middle class folk do?  Doomscroll and goon to abundant modern online porn.
